    Appt. Date 8-6-25 R.O#565523 FIRST AND FOREMOST: Daniel Garcia, Service Writer is unprofessional, rude and to top it all off, unknowledgeable. Dropped vehicle off for a diagnostic ($220) with a small evap leak. Mr. Garcia claims the repair will be $440. Gas cap replacement & Labor. He let me know the cap was roughly $100, implying the labor to install the gas cap is $330?! SECONDLY: Picture Included. Labeling a repair as "Critical" implies that the vehicle is unsafe to operate, at risk of imminent failure, or likely to sustain further damage if not immediately addressed. In this case, the dealer recommended replacing the thermostat and fan switch for $811.67, citing only that the vehicle was "due for service" -- not that there was an actual failure, leak, or diagnostic trouble code (DTC) indicating a malfunction. If the thermostat or fan switch were truly failing, the vehicle would typically display one or more of the following symptoms: * Warning lights or DTCs (e.g., check engine light or cooling system fault code) * Overheating or inability to reach proper operating temperature * Coolant leaks or visible damage to components * Erratic temperature gauge readings The absence of these signs suggests that the parts are functioning as intended. Recommending immediate replacement under the label "Critical" without diagnostic evidence could be considered misleading or fraudulent behavior, as it pressures the customer into paying for unnecessary work. In automotive repair ethics, a "Critical" designation should be reserved for repairs required for safe operation or to prevent imminent damage -- not routine maintenance. This misclassification can be a tactic to inflate repair bills, undermining customer trust and potentially violating consumer protection laws related to deceptive trade practices. Daniel explained it "could" leak at some point. "Could" and then also referred to this as regular maintence. We paid for the diagnostic, and took the vehicle. Purchased a gas cap and saved $330 on the labor. Thanks Carson Honda, this dealership could use some serious training.

    Ask the Community - Carson Honda

    Does the dealer have to run my credit if I have my own financing?

    Nope. But be prepared to put up a fight over this with Carson Honda. Whatever you do, do not provide your social security number and do NOT sign the "Credit Application" that they claim to use to register your vehicle with the DMV.
